30.79 billion yuan
China's lottery sales rose 12.6 percent year-on-year to 30.79 billion yuan ($4.96 billion) in May, data showed on Friday. In the first five months of 2014, total lottery sales stood at 142.36 billion yuan, up 13.9 percent from a year earlier, the Ministry of Finance said in a statement. Money raised through lotteries is used for the jackpot, management fees and public welfare. Last year, total lottery sales topped 309 billion yuan, up 18.3 percent year-on-year, the ministry's data showed.
